Heap-based buffer overflow in BusyBox - CVE-2016-2148
Published: June 4, 2019
Vulnerability details
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code on the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to a boundary error in udhcpc client when parsing DHCP packets with specially crafted OPTION_6RD option. A remote attacker can trick the victim to connect to malicious DHCP server, trigger heap-based buffer overflow and execute arbitrary code on the target system.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may result in complete compromise of vulnerable system.
